Banking.
A strengthened EU Capital Requirements Directive (CRD), 2013/36/EU, the bulk of which took effect from early 2014.
The related rules and supervisory statements to implement CRD IV in the UK are set out in the Prudential Regulatory Authority (PRA)'s Policy Statement PS7/13.
The PRA's statement refers to the CRD and the related Capital Requirements Regulation (575/2013) as jointly comprising CRD IV.
